Well i think the clutch is gone on my 20 can't even slow down the drive train to put er in gear have to just jumper in and i know that's not good. I have tried adjusting the clutch pedal by loosening it and readjusting. just doesn't do any good. any advise guys.

Are you saying the clutch doesn't disengage? If that's the problem, just tie her to a large tree; depress pedal and slip the clutch to remove the rust/crud holding it to the flywheel. I had to do this when I first got my TO30; don't get the clutch too hot. The clutch will break free if that's the problem, if not you'll just dig two holes. That's my way. BTW, clutch adjustment is 3/16" free travel between pedal and footpeg.
